How to watch the World Series

Two of the most popular teams in baseball, the Los Angeles Dodgers and the New York Yankees, go head to head. Here's how to watch.

LOS ANGELES — It's that time of year. The 2024 World Series, pitting the Los Angeles Dodgers against the News York Yankees, starts on Friday. October 25. Here's how and when to watch:

All games will be broadcast on FOX, and you can watch them right here on FOX54. All times are Central.

Game 1 - Friday, Oct. 25, 7:00pm at Dodger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 2 - Saturday, Oct. 26, 7:00pm at Dodger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 3 - Monday, Oct. 28, 7:00pm at Yankee Stadium  (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 4 - Tuesday, Oct. 29, 7:00pm at Yankee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 5 - Wednesday, Oct. 30, 7:00 at Yankee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 6 (if needed) - Friday, Nov. 1 at Dodger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)
Game 7 (if needed) - Saturday, Nov. 2 at Dodger Stadium (MLB World Series Pregame Show 6:00pm)

The Yankees and the Dodgers have met in the World Series a record 11 times, and this year will make 12.

Longtime Dodger favorite Fernando Valenzuela passed away on October 22. The team plans to wear a number 34 uniform patch in his honor during the World Series. His pitching career stretched for 17 years, 10 years of those with the Dodgers. He was a National League All-Star from 1981-1986. After he retired from baseball, he returned to the Dodgers as a broadcaster for 21 years, from 2023 to 2024. His number 34 was retired in 2023
